Queens Lake Middle School, a public school located in Williamsburg, VA, serves grades 6-8 in the York County Public Schools.It has received a GreatSchools Rating of 8 out of 10, based on a variety of school quality measures.

Queens Lake Middle School is a public school located in Williamsburg, VA. 554 students attend Queens Lake Middle School.

Test Scores 8/10 The Test Score Rating examines how students at this school performed on standardized tests compared with other schools in the state. The Test Rating was created using 2025 Virginia Standards of Learning data from Virginia Department of Education, and using 2025 Virginia Standards of Learning (SOL) End-of-Course data from Virginia Department of Education.
Student Growth 8/10 The Student Progress Rating measures whether students at this school are making academic progress over time based on student growth data provided by the Department of Education. Specifically, this rating looks at how much progress individual students have made on state assessments during the past year or more, how this performance aligns with expected progress based on a student growth model established by the state Department of Education, and how this school's growth data compares to other schools in the state. The Growth Rating was created using 2025 Student growth data from Virginia Department of Education.

We recently moved to this area from out of state. During our search, we specifically looked at schools in York County, reason behind our move to this particular area. The teachers are lazy at best. My child is a 6th grade student and if she does not complete an assignment or homework, instead of notifying the parents, the teachers ignore the problem until the parent brings it up when the report cards come out. Teachers are "supposed" to use Edline to post assignments and grades, but only a few teachers do. My child dropped two grades in one subject in less than a month. I was told that she wasn't completing homework, but Edline shows no assignments and I was never notified. Maybe other York County schools are good, but skip this one! It is well not worth the headache to deal with this administration!
